Rafael Spilki Postado Maio 17, 2010 Denunciar Share Postado Maio 17, 2010 Bom dia!Alguém sabe porque o uso desse código abaixo faz funcionar somente o segundo onload?<script> window.onload = function(){ obj = document.getElementsByName('chcDataf'); for(i = 0;i < obj.length; i++){ if(obj[i].checked) vstatus = obj[i].value; } manipulaDiv(vstatus); } </script> <script> window.onload = function(){ obj = document.getElementsByName('quite'); for(i = 0;i < obj.length; i++){ if(obj[i].checked) vstatus = obj[i].value; } manipulaDiv1(vstatus); } </script>Se eu testo um de cada vez os dois funcionam, mas juntos não... alguém sabe o porque e como corrigir?[]'s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 *FIT* Postado Maio 17, 2010 Denunciar Share Postado Maio 17, 2010 Opa...como vai Rafael, tudo bom?Veja se isso te ajuda, abraços!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 kuroi Postado Maio 17, 2010 Denunciar Share Postado Maio 17, 2010 rafael, acho q a segunda vez, a nova function apaga a primera, por isso so a segunda é chamada.se você pusesse os dois codigos na mesma function, ou declarasse as duas funcoes e chamasse as duas resolveria. assim ó:function x() { obj = document.getElementsByName('chcDataf'); for(i = 0;i < obj.length; i++){ if(obj[i].checked) vstatus = obj[i].value; } manipulaDiv(vstatus);}function y() { obj = document.getElementsByName('quite'); for(i = 0;i < obj.length; i++){ if(obj[i].checked) vstatus = obj[i].value; } manipulaDiv1(vstatus);}window.onload = function() { x(); y();}[/code]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 Rafael Spilki Postado Maio 17, 2010 Autor Denunciar Share Postado Maio 17, 2010 Bah, que rateada!Valeu pessoal...Funcionou aqui![]'s Citar Link para o comentário Compartilhar em outros sites More sharing options...
Pergunta
Rafael Spilki
Bom dia!
Alguém sabe porque o uso desse código abaixo faz funcionar somente o segundo onload?
Se eu testo um de cada vez os dois funcionam, mas juntos não... alguém sabe o porque e como corrigir?
[]'s
Link para o comentário
Compartilhar em outros sites
3 respostass a esta questão
Posts Recomendados
Participe da discussão
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.